Welcome to the xxxst European Study Group with Industry, which will take place at the University of Beira Interior in Covilhã, Portugal, during the summer of 2026.
The European Study Groups with Industry (ESGI) was established in Oxford in 1968, initially named the Oxford Study Groups with Industry. Study Groups are intense week-long, collaborative workshops focused on problem-solving, offering an interesting opportunity for interaction among mathematicians, scientists, and industrial professionals.
A restricted quantity of challenges put forth by companies will be chosen by the scientific committee for resolution during ESGIxxx. On the inaugural day of this event, academic participants will assign themselves to a working group, each of which will collaborate with an industrial partner on a specific challenge throughout the week. On the final day, each group will present the primary findings and propose routes for future research.
A few weeks after the study group, a technical report detailing the contributions of each group will be dispatched to the respective industrial partner. It will encompass the principal outcomes attained on the ESGI, along with additional recommendations for future advancements.
